Marion vs Kansas City
Side-by-side comparison
How does Marion, KS compare to Kansas City, KS? Marion has a population of 2,010 with a median household income of $60,756, while Kansas City has 154,776 residents and a median income of $59,183.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Marion, KS | Kansas City, KS |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 2,010 | 154,776 | -98.7% |
| Median Age | 47.1 | 34 | +38.5% |
| Foreign Born % | 1.3% | 18.6% | -93.0% |
